WebAug 6, 2024 · Unlike bipolar I and II disorders, the highs and lows of cyclothymia are not severe enough to fit the full criteria for manic, hypomanic, or major depressive episodes. However, these symptoms must be present for at least half the time for a period of at least two years, with no symptom-free period for more than two months. WebThe vast majority of people with bipolar II disorder experience more time with depressive than hypomanic symptoms. Depressions can occur soon after hypomania subsides, or much later. WebJan 31, 2024 · It appears that aripiprazole, ziprasidone, lurasidone and cariprazine are more weight neutral than the others, but that can vary from person to person. Antidepressants along with a mood stabilizer or antipsychotic may be used in treating bipolar disorder, though antidepressants alone could cause mania or rapid cycling in people with bipolar ...
